We used them for human consumption and as fodder for animals, there are five types of millet that are Perl Millet or bajra, Finger Millet OR Ragi, Foxtail Millet OR Navne, Sorghum or Jowar/Jola, Barnyard Millet, Proso Millet OR Baragu/Varagu, … Tīmeklis2024. gada 5. maijs · Kharif crops require warm wet weather at the time of growth and a shorter length of day for flowering. On the contrary, cold and dry weather is needed for growing rabi crops and longer day length for its flowering. Kharif crops are sown in June and July. Kharif Season Crops : These crops are grown during the rainy season from the month of June to October, e.g., Paddy (rice), soyabean, Sugar cane.. Rabi Season Crops : These crops are grown during the winter reason from the month of November to April. e.g. wheat, gram, …
